Working Principle
Film capacitors work on the principle of dielectric polarization. When an electric field is applied, polar molecules in the film become aligned toward the electric field and this creates an electric dipole, or two poles of opposing charges. The polarization of the molecules due to the electric field results in a change in the electrical properties of the dielectric film, which further influences the capacitance of the capacitor.
